Tri-Star Computer and Visio Announce Strategic Alliance to Bundle Visio Technical 5.0.PHOENIX--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Nov. 5, 1997--TRI-STAR COMPUTER Wednesday announced an agreement with Visio Corp. to ship Visio(R) Technical 5.0 with four configurations of the StarStation workstation. Visio Technical 5.0, the newest version of this popular software program helps users create and share 2D technical drawings and schematics. Ted Johnson, co-founder, executive vice-president and chief technology officer at Visio Corp. said, "Visio Technical's innovative approach to technical drawing, including industry-leading support for advanced Windows-based technology and its extensive SmartShapes(R) symbol library, has positioned it as a premier 2-D technical drawing application." "We are pleased with Tri-Star's inclusion of Visio Technical 5.0 within configurations of the StarStation workstation, thus reinforcing customer's preference for a widely-accessible and affordable technical drawing solution," Johnson added. Founded in 1988, Tri-Star Computer Corp. is a privately-held company that manufactures low-cost, high-quality, high-performance Windows NT workstations and servers. Tri-Star workstations and servers are used mainly by graphic intensive software users in the CAD/CAM/CAE, multimedia and 3D animation markets. Tri-Star's standard and customized workstations are primarily sold to end users via direct mail catalogs and selectively through specialized Value Added Resellers. Company headquarters are at 3832 E.
